hi i have completed my diploma in biomedical engineering ? can i persue any medical course ? i really wanna join medical feild need help

priyaankasarkar Student Expert 8th Jul, 2020

The medical courses in India are MBBS, BDS, Ayush and Veterinary courses, Courses like Physiotherapy, Rehabilitation Therapy, Occupation Therapy fall under Para Medical Courses. And NEET is the entrance examination for admission to MBBS,BDS, Ayush and Veterinary courses across India. So to be eligible for NEET, you should have completed your 12th, passed in all subjects and secure a minimum aggregate of 50% in Physics, Chemistry and Biology. It is 50% for General Category, 45% for PWD and 40% for OBC,SC,ST. Now if you belong to OBC Category, the Category you belong to should be also listed in the Central OBC list. Or else you will be considered as General Category and so you have to secure a minimum aggregate of 50% in Physics, Chemistry and Biology. This 50% is inclusive of the Theory and Practical marks scored in Physics, Chemistry and Biology collectively. You needn't score 50% in Physics, 50% in Chemistry and 50% in Biology separately. You need an aggregate of 50% or 40% depending on your Category as an aggregate in Physics, Chemistry and Biology. And along with Physics, Chemistry and Biology, you should also have studied English as one of the core subjects in your 12th. So if you studied Physics, Chemistry and Biology in your 12th, you can appear for NEET and study any of the medical courses. If you have studied Biology as an additional subject, even then you can appear for NEET. But if you haven't studied Biology, unfortunately you can pursue Medical Courses but you can pursue B.Pharmacy.

How good should my 12th percent be for getting confirmed admission to Sunandan Divatia School of Science for integrated MSc biomedical science ?

Bhawna Mehbubani 14th May, 2020

Hello Aditi,

The eligibility criteria for admission to Sunandan Divatia School of Science for integrated MSc. Biomedical Science is a minimum of 60% aggregate marks at Higher Secondary School Certificate (10+2) or equivalent examination from the Science stream with Biology as compulsory subject.

However,the merit list will be based on the marks obtained in Biology in 10+2 or equivalent examination. Additional weightage (5%) will be given to students having minimum 60% marks in Chemistry.

Though I have mentioned the minimum criteria, but the better your 12th percentage will be, the more you stand a chance for admission here. A percentage about 90, can give you can confirmed admission here.
